16.4.2 Serial Pin Multiplexed Mode 1
(SMR0 Register [bits SM2, SM1, SM0] = [0 0 1])
This mode is “COM1 snoop mode” with use of SCI_1 and internal registers. CTS, RTS, RxDF,
and TxDF of SCIF are connected to COM1. RxD1 of SCI_1 is connected to RxDF of SCIF
internally and TxD1 of SCI_1 is unused.
So, COM2 is not available (N/A) and Rx of COM2 is fixed at 1. RxD3 and TxD3 of SCI_3 are
cross-connected to COM3.
The pin state of CTS of COM1 is reflected in bit CTS1 of the SMR1 register.
Figure 16.2 illustrates the pin connection in serial pin multiplexed mode 1.
